Skip to content

Instantly share code, notes, and snippets.

@parzibyte
Created January 13, 2021 17:33
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save parzibyte/0c36f640de3f9ac9947e460c5d74fd1f to your computer and use it in GitHub Desktop.
Save parzibyte/0c36f640de3f9ac9947e460c5d74fd1f to your computer and use it in GitHub Desktop.
void preorden(struct nodoCadena *nodo)
{
if (nodo != NULL)
{
printf("%s,", nodo->cadena);
preorden(nodo->izquierda);
preorden(nodo->derecha);
}
}
void inorden(struct nodoCadena *nodo)
{
if (nodo != NULL)
{
inorden(nodo->izquierda);
printf("%s,", nodo->cadena);
inorden(nodo->derecha);
}
}
void postorden(struct nodoCadena *nodo)
{
if (nodo != NULL)
{
postorden(nodo->izquierda);
postorden(nodo->derecha);
printf("%s,", nodo->cadena);
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ment